#include <u.h>
#include <libc.h>
#include <../boot/boot.h>
static void
configdkconc(char *ctl, char *arg)
{
int cfd;
char buf[1024], *p;
/*
if(fork() == 0){
cfd = open("#c/klog", OREAD);
while((n = read(cfd, buf, sizeof buf)) > 0)
if(write(1, buf, n) < 0)
break;
_exits(0);
}
*/
p = strchr(arg, ';');
cfd = open(ctl, ORDWR);
if(arg == 0 || p == 0 || cfd < 0){
sprint(buf, "opening %s", ctl);
fatal(buf);
}
*p++ = 0;
sendmsg(cfd, "push conc");
sendmsg(cfd, arg);
close(cfd);
ctl = "#Kconc/conc/0/ctl";
cfd = open(ctl, ORDWR);
if(cfd < 0){
sprint(buf, "opening %s", ctl);
fatal(buf);
}
sendmsg(cfd, "push dkmux");
sendmsg(cfd, p);
close(cfd);
}
static void
configdatakit(char *ctl, char *arg)
{
int cfd;
char buf[64];
cfd = open(ctl, ORDWR);
if(arg == 0 || cfd < 0){
sprint(buf, "opening %s", ctl);
fatal(buf);
}
sendmsg(cfd, "push dkmux");
sendmsg(cfd, arg);
close(cfd);
}
void
confighs(Method *mp)
{
configdatakit("#h/ctl", mp->arg);
}
int
authhs(void)
{
return dkauth();
}
int
connecths(void)
{
return dkconnect();
}
void
configincon(Method *mp)
{
configdatakit("#i/ctl", mp->arg);
}
int
authincon(void)
{
return dkauth();
}
int
connectincon(void)
{
return dkconnect();
}
void
configcincon(Method *mp)
{
configdkconc("#i/ctl", mp->arg);
}
int
authcincon(void)
{
return dkauth();
}
int
connectcincon(void)
{
return dkconnect();
}
